Kitsch Café Vintage

Drew Steinbrecher of Kitsch Café Vintage offers items that are fun, unique and stylish. However, he admits some items are so bad that they've come all the way back around to cool, hence the term 'kitsch.' The vintage paper packs Drew offers have been very popular & provide crafters with unique materials for various projects. The Faux Bois Porta File is perfect for storing different goodies.
